    A paper bag machine is a high-speed, automated piece of equipment designed to convert rolls of kraft paper or similar materials into finished paper bags. Depending on the design and specifications, machines can produce flat bottom bags, square bottom bags, or even handle-attached bags. These machines can range in output capacity from several dozen bags per minute to over 600, depending on complexity and technology integration.

    The process typically starts with a large roll of paper being fed into the machine. It is printed, if branding or instructions are needed, and then cut to the appropriate length. The machine folds, glues, shapes, and compresses the paper into bags of desired dimensions and strength. Some advanced paper bag machines can even insert twisted or flat handles and perform quality checks in a single pass.

    Technological innovation has significantly enhanced the capabilities of paper bag machines. Modern versions come equipped with PLC control systems, touchscreen interfaces, servo motors for precise folding and cutting, and automatic error detection functions.     One of the key advantages of using paper bag machines is scalability. From small-scale artisanal production to massive industrial operations, the machines can be tailored to fit various levels of output. This adaptability has made them indispensable for both regional and global bag manufacturers.

    Moreover, the resurgence in paper bag demand—particularly post-2018 when countries began enforcing bans or levies on plastic bags—has ignited a new wave of investment in this sector. China, India, Germany, and the United States have emerged as leading hubs for manufacturing and exporting these machines. As a result, international trade fairs and expos often showcase breakthroughs in speed, precision, automation, and eco-friendliness.

    However, paper bag machines are not without their challenges. The rising cost of raw materials, supply chain disruptions, and the need for frequent maintenance can impact production efficiency. Still, ongoing R&D efforts are tackling these issues by exploring recyclable coatings, smart sensors, and AI-assisted operation to reduce waste and downtime.
